A brunette Sarah Michelle Gellar stars opposite Alec Baldwin in this romantic coming-of-age story loosely based on the popular Melissa Banks book THE GIRL'S GUIDE TO HUNTING AND FISHING. Gellar plays Brett Eisenberg, a young woman working her way up New York City's publishing ladder. Eager to get ahead, Brett attends a book signing with hopes of meeting influential publishing giant Archie Knox (Alec Baldwin). No sooner do they trade glances than Archie is wooing Brett with extravagant dates, expensive gifts, and career assistance. The relationship is a storybook romance from the start, but slowly gets much more complicated due to the age difference and Archie's alcoholism.Viewers might initially struggle to relate to the young protagonist--things seem to come a bit too easily for Brett, who conveniently lives rent-free in her grandmother's vacant and fancy Manhattan apartment. That said, it's easy to understand why the filmmakers chose this scenario, as New York does look better through the eyes of privilege. It is a land mysteriously without subways, and where every building has a doorman. The setting is contrived, but the romance manages to feel authentic. Watching Archie, anyone can see how a girl could easily swoon over him. Baldwin is extremely charming as a flawed but charismatic man close in age to Brett's father. SUBURBAN GIRL is highly entertaining throughout, and a fine showcase for Baldwin, who, playing a character with eerie similarities to himself, is a joy to watch.

    Im used to Sarah in more powerful roles, i was looking forward to seeing a softer side but I was a little disappointed. She enters into a relationship with an older man and time seems to fast forward to an issue here and an issue there between them, then bam! the movie focuses on her dad becoming ill. She is trying to find herself throughout the movie but Im not sure she realizes as a character that she is even looking for anything. She comes across as a book smart but utterly naive young girl rebelling against her fathers coddling while also indulging in it and playing grownup with the novelty of an older man. Movie also plays on her boyfriend having a fatherly role in her life while also being an absent tee father to his actual daughter, which is sarah's characters age. The only salvage to the movie was that they actually really loved one another.
